Cyk algorithm examples

WebJun 15, 2024 · Example. CYK algorithm is used to find whether the given Context free grammar generates a ... WebThe CYK algorithm is a simple application of dynamic programming to parsing. Dynamic programming terminology may be thought of as static memoization. A memoized function looks up its argument in a table, and adds the result to the table if the argument isn't found. ... A similar example is the Hindley-Milner algorithm. Milner published a paper ...

CYK Algorithm CYK Algorithm Example Gate Vidyalay

WebThe CYK Algorithm •The membership problem: –Problem: •Given a context-free grammar G and a string w –G = (V, ∑,P , S) where » V finite set of variables » ∑ (the alphabet) … WebCYK Algorithm: More Details Jim Anderson (modified by Nathan Otterness) 11 → → → 𝑥= (𝑛=5) i → j a a a b b In this case, we want strings starting at position 2 of length 3. A … simply mercedes https://jpbarnhart.com

Tutorial #15: Parsing I context-free grammars and the CYK …

WebOct 21, 2024 · CYK algorithm implementation. I'm trying to implement the CYK pseudo code provided by wikipedia. The example sentence I input should be outputting True, … WebJun 14, 2024 · To make the CYK algorithm easier to understand, we’ll use the worked example of parsing the sentence I saw him with the binoculars . We already saw in … WebThe first one is a file containing the grammar (see below for an example) and the second one a file containing the input sentence. python3 cyk_parser.py /home/Users/god/grammar.txt /home/Users/god/sentences/pajamas.txt Using /home/Users/god/grammar.txt as path for the grammar and … raytheon technologies legal department

c++ - How does the CYK algorithm work? - Stack Overflow

Category:CS470/570: CYK Algorithm - Yale University

Tags:Cyk algorithm examples

Cyk algorithm examples

The CYK Algorithm - School of Informatics, University of …

WebJan 1, 2013 · Abstract. Stochastic context-free grammars (SCFGs) were first established in the context of natural language modelling, and only later found their applications in RNA secondary structure prediction. In this chapter, we discuss the basic SCFG algorithms (CYK and inside–outside algorithms) in an application-centered manner and use the … WebCYK Algorithm CYK Algorithm Example CYK Algorithm-. CYK Algorithm is a membership algorithm of context free grammar. It is used to …

Cyk algorithm examples

Did you know?

WebNov 19, 2024 · The CYK algorithm is an efficient algorithm for determining whether a string is in the language generated by a context-free grammar. It uses dynamic programming and is fastest when the input grammar is in Chomsky normal form. Learn more… Top users Synonyms 37 questions Newest Active Filter 0 votes 0 answers 20 views WebFor example, if the state ('NP', 3, 'Det', 'Noun') ... We will now implement a weighted CYK algorithm to parse a sentence and return the most probable parse tree. The grammar is defined in pcfg_grammar_original.txt. As you can notice, some of the rules are not in CNF.

WebCYK Algorithm The algorithm we have worked out is called the CKY (Cocke, Younger, Kasami) algorithm. It answers the question: given grammar G and string w, is w 2L(G)? … WebCFG (Context-Free Grammar) parser + CYK (Cocke-Younger-Kasami) algorithm to determine whether a string is in the language. - GitHub - xDimGG/cyk-algorithm: CFG (Context-Free Grammar) parser + CYK (Cocke-Younger-Kasami) algorithm to determine whether a string is in the language. ... example.py. cfg parser. April 12, 2024 12:53. …

WebJul 19, 2024 · The CYK algorithm is what you get when you take the above recursive algorithm and memoize the result, or equivalently when you convert the above recursive algorithm into a dynamic programming problem. There are O (n 2 N) possible recursive calls. For each production tried, it does O (n) work. WebIntroduction. Construction of parsing tables using CYK (Cocke–Younger–Kasami) algorithm for CNF grammars.

WebThe CYK Algorithm Basics The Structure of the rules in a Chomsky Normal Form grammar Uses a “dynamic programming” or “table-filling algorithm” Chomsky Normal Form …

WebMay 4, 2024 · Molly Ruby in Towards Data Science How ChatGPT Works: The Models Behind The Bot Albers Uzila in Towards Data Science Beautifully Illustrated: NLP Models from RNN to Transformer Somnath … simply mercedes 2022WebThe CYK algorithm is a dynamic-programming parsing algorithm utilized to compute whether or not a provided string is valid according to a context-free grammar specified in CNF (Chomsky-Normal Form). If the string is valid, the CYK algorithm will also be able to tell us the possible parse sequences of that string. General (High-Level Idea): raytheon technologies leaving fidelityWebThe CYK Algorithm, presented below, is an example of a problem-solving approach known as Dynamic Programming. In this approach, the computation of some desired value … simply me prom dressesWebThe CYK algorithm has a number of fascinating qualities. First and foremost, context-free languages are an important part of the Chomsky hierarchy, and this algorithm shows … simply me photographyWebThe CYK algorithm is a simple application of dynamic programming to parsing. Dynamic programming terminology may be thought of as static memoization. A memoized function … raytheon technologies louisvilleWebEarley parsing: example Comparing Earley and CYK 2/31. Note about CYK The CYK algorithm parses input strings in Chomsky normal form. ... Note about CYK The CYK algorithm parses input strings in Chomsky normal form. Can you see how to change it to an algorithm with an arbitrary RHS length (of only nonterminals)? ... raytheon technologies locations in floridaWebApr 15, 2013 · Initialize all elements of P to false. for each i = 1 to n for each unit production Rj -> ai set P [i,1,j] = true for each i = 2 to n -- Length of span for each j = 1 to n-i+1 -- Start of span for each k = 1 to i-1 -- Partition of span for each production RA -> RB RC if P [j,k,B] and P [j+k,i-k,C] then set P [j,i,A] = true if any of P [1,n,x] is … raytheon technologies livingston